site stats

Bitset operations

WebTo go into details, searches and queries with filtering in knowhere are facilitated by bitset. And the underlying mechanism behind Time Travel is enabled by bitset. When a search is conducted, the segcore obtains a bitset indicating if the timestamp meets the condition. Then Milvus judges the range of data to query or search based on this bitset. WebJan 27, 2024 · std:: bitset. std:: bitset. The class template bitset represents a fixed-size sequence of N bits. Bitsets can be manipulated by standard logic operators and …

O.3 — Bit manipulation with bitwise operators and bit masks

Webbitset<365> is a binary number with $$$365$$$ bits available, and it supports most of binary operations. The code above changes into simple: code Some functions ... WebThe contents of one BitSet may be changed by other BitSet using logical AND, logical OR and logical exclusive OR operations. The index of bits of BitSet class is represented by positive integers. Each element of bits contains either true or false value. Initially, all bits of a set have the false value. can an employer change your start date https://tuttlefilms.com

C++ Bitset Library - bitset() Function - tutorialspoint.com

WebIntroduction. Let's learn bitwise operations that are useful in Competitive Programming. Prerequisite is knowing the binary system. For example, the following must be clear for you already. 13 = 1 ⋅ 8 + 1 ⋅ 4 + 0 ⋅ 2 + 1 ⋅ 1 = 1101 ( 2) = 00001101 ( 2) Keep in mind that we can pad a number with leading zeros to get the length equal to ... WebC Library - Bitset represents a fixed-size sequence of N bits and stores values either 0 or 1. Zero means value is false or bit is unset and one means value is true or bit is set. Bitset class emulates space efficient array of boolean values, where each element occupies only one … WebMay 26, 2024 · BitSet bitSet = new BitSet(); bitSet.set(15, 25); bitSet.stream().forEach(System.out::println); This will print all set bits to the console. Since this will return an IntStream , we can perform common … can an employer breathalyse an employee usa

C++ 通过char*缓冲区读取int的行为不同,无论是正的还是负的

Category:c++ - Is bitset faster than an array of bools? - Stack Overflow

Tags:Bitset operations

Bitset operations

bitset Class Microsoft Learn

WebConfusing bitsets. Despite I am big fan of bitsets, I don't even know what is the exact time complexity. I think operation OR, XOR and etc. works in O ( s i z e 64), the explanation is that solutions which used it got AC. But on the other hand, I have read in blogs that there would be 32 instead of 64. Please help me, what is the exact time ... WebA bit array (also known as bitmask, [1] bit map, bit set, bit string, or bit vector) is an array data structure that compactly stores bits. It can be used to implement a simple set data …

Bitset operations

Did you know?

WebAug 16, 2024 · The logical operations supported are : and, andNot, or, Xor. These are discussed in this article. 1. and (Bitset set) : This method performs a logical AND of this … WebJan 10, 2024 · In this article. Applies to: SQL Server 2024 (16.x) Azure SQL Database Azure SQL Managed Instance Bit manipulation functions such as moving, retrieving …

WebJun 15, 2024 · The bitset class supports operations on objects of type bitset that contain a collection of bits and provide constant-time access to each bit. Syntax template WebJan 24, 2024 · Bits that are shifted off the end of the binary number are lost forever. The bitwise right shift (&gt;&gt;) operator shifts bits to the right. 1100 &gt;&gt; 1 is 0110. 1100 &gt;&gt; 2 is 0011. 1100 &gt;&gt; 3 is 0001. Note that in the third case we shifted a …

WebTutorials and Articles to provide Simple and Easy Learning on Technical and Non-Technical Subjects. These tutorials and articles have been created by industry experts … WebUse bitset::test to access the value with bitset bounds checked. Parameters pos Order position of the bit whose value is accessed. Order positions are counted from the …

WebThe bits of a BitSet are indexed by nonnegative integers. Individual indexed bits can be examined, set, or cleared. One BitSet may be used to modify the contents of another …

WebFeb 22, 2024 · A bit mask is a predefined set of bits that is used to select which specific bits will be modified by subsequent operations. ... Bit masks and std::bitset. std::bitset supports the full set of bitwise operators. So even though it’s easier to use the functions (test, set, reset, and flip) to modify individual bits, you can use bitwise ... can an employer change your time sheetWebThe bits of a BitSet are indexed by nonnegative integers. Individual indexed bits can be examined, set, or cleared. One BitSet may be used to modify the contents of another BitSet through logical AND, logical inclusive OR, and logical exclusive OR operations. By default, all bits in the set initially have the value false. can an employer change your shift timeWebC++ 通过char*缓冲区读取int的行为不同,无论是正的还是负的,c++,binary-deserialization,C++,Binary Deserialization,背景:我想知道如果我们通过char*缓冲区获取二进制数据,如何手动反序列化它们 假设:作为一个极小的例子,我们将在这里考虑: 我只有一个int通过char*缓冲区序列化。 can an employer change my timesheetWebJun 13, 2024 · The answer is you don't. Assume you have a bitset of n size. Let's look at the xor operator ^ . It obviously has to look at each bit in both operands, so it makes 2n … can an employer blacklist you in californiaWebDec 18, 2011 · Description Bitset is a class that describes objects that can store a sequence consisting of a fixed number of bits. A bit is set if its value is 1, reset if its value is 0. A simple example of creating a bitset is: std:: bitset < 8 > bS; // creates a bitset holding 8 bits all initialized to 0. Bitset is very similar to vector (also known as bit_vector): it … can an employer cancel your shift ontarioWebDefinition of bitset in the Definitions.net dictionary. Meaning of bitset. What does bitset mean? Information and translations of bitset in the most comprehensive dictionary … can an employer call you on vacationWebJan 10, 2024 · In this article. Applies to: SQL Server 2024 (16.x) Azure SQL Database Azure SQL Managed Instance Bit manipulation functions such as moving, retrieving (getting), setting, or counting single bits within an integer or binary value, allow you to process and store data more efficiently than with individual bits. fisher speakers vintage